本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网、大数据、云计算等技术的飞速发展,分布式系统已成为现代IT架构的核心,在分布式系统中,分布式输入节点作为架构的核心组成部分,承担着数据采集、处理和传输的重要任务,本文将深入解析分布式输入节点的概念、架构、关键技术以及在实际应用中的优势。
分布式输入节点的概念
分布式输入节点,顾名思义,是指在分布式系统中负责接收、处理和转发数据的节点,其主要功能包括:
1、数据采集:从各种数据源(如数据库、日志文件、网络接口等)获取数据。
2、数据处理:对采集到的数据进行清洗、转换、聚合等操作,以满足后续处理需求。
3、数据传输:将处理后的数据传输至其他节点,如分布式计算节点、存储节点等。
分布式输入节点的架构
分布式输入节点通常采用以下架构:
1、数据采集模块:负责从各种数据源获取数据,如数据库连接池、日志解析器、网络爬虫等。
图片来源于网络,如有侵权联系删除
2、数据处理模块:对采集到的数据进行清洗、转换、聚合等操作,以满足后续处理需求,该模块可包括数据清洗、数据转换、数据聚合等功能。
3、数据传输模块:将处理后的数据传输至其他节点,如分布式计算节点、存储节点等,该模块可采用消息队列、数据总线等技术实现。
4、控制模块:负责协调各个模块的运行,如任务分发、状态监控、故障处理等。
分布式输入节点的关键技术
1、数据采集技术:包括数据库连接池、日志解析器、网络爬虫等,这些技术能够高效地从各种数据源采集数据。
2、数据处理技术:包括数据清洗、数据转换、数据聚合等,这些技术能够对采集到的数据进行加工,以满足后续处理需求。
3、数据传输技术:包括消息队列、数据总线等技术,这些技术能够实现高效、可靠的数据传输。
4、高并发处理技术:在分布式系统中,节点数量众多,数据量巨大,分布式输入节点需要具备高并发处理能力,以保证系统稳定运行。
图片来源于网络,如有侵权联系删除
5、负载均衡技术:通过合理分配任务,实现节点负载均衡,提高系统性能。
分布式输入节点的优势
1、高效性:分布式输入节点能够并行处理大量数据,提高数据处理效率。
2、可靠性:通过分布式架构,分布式输入节点具有较高的容错能力,即使部分节点故障,系统仍能正常运行。
3、扩展性:分布式输入节点可根据需求进行水平扩展,满足不断增长的数据量。
4、可维护性:分布式输入节点采用模块化设计,便于维护和升级。
分布式输入节点作为分布式系统架构的核心组成部分,在数据采集、处理和传输方面发挥着重要作用,了解其概念、架构、关键技术以及优势,有助于我们更好地构建高效、可靠、可扩展的分布式系统。
标签: #分布式输入节点是什么
评论列表